Health Protection Agency (HPA) on Monday announced two additional COVID-19 fatalities in Maldives.

According to the agency, both victims were local men who passed away one in Baa Atoll Eydhafushi and the other in Maafushi, Kaafu Atoll.

The man from Eydhafushi was 85-years-old and taken to Baa Eydhafushi Atoll hospital. He was declared dead at 0830hrs.

A little over an hour later, the 74-year-old man from Maafushi was declared dead at 0945hrs. He was tested positive afterwards.

This is the third death reported so far today. Earlier a 75-year-old Maldivian female admitted to IGMH ER was declared dead at 0400hrs.

With these developments, Maldives recorded 87 deaths in relation to COVID-19.

Currently, the country is experiencing its worst waves of COVID to date and recorded the highest number of cases within 24 hours on Sunday with 1,091 being tested positive.

Maldives recorded its first COVID related death on April 29, 2020.
